On 23rd December, 2020, the Council of State issued a decision on the environmental permit for Windpark Staphorst. The wind farm, developed by the Coöperatie Wij Duurzaam Staphorst, consists of three wind turbines.
With Pondera’s support, the cooperative submitted a plan to the municipality of Staphorst in 2018 in response to the municipality’s call to do so. The cooperative’s plan emerged as the best out of the five submitted plans following an assessment of process participation, spatial quality and financial participation. In a process of consultation group and public meetings, supported by the EIA process, a preferred alternative was chosen. The municipality of Staphorst issued an environmental permit for this in October 2019. The objections to the appeal against this permit were assessed by the Council of State and discussed in the session in September 2020. There has now been a ruling.
The Council of State has concluded that all the objections are unfounded or inadmissible. This means that the investigations were carried out correctly and thoroughly, and that the preparations by the cooperative and the procedure of the municipality were carried out carefully. The wind farm can therefore continue with the preparations for construction. In its decision, the Council of State requests that the noise values specified by the cooperative as a maximum and explained at the hearing, also be attached to the permit as a requirement.
